    • May Golie«i»«sup»5«/i»«/sup» PAYNE was born at Cow Head, District of St. Barbe, Newfoundland November 1910. May died at an unknown location, at age unknown. She married John Francis BENOIT December 11, 1929 at St. Paul's, District of St. Barbe, Newfoundland. No. 93 - BENOIT and PAYNE - 1929 Dec 11 - Marriage solemnized at St. Paul's in the Mission of Cow Head in the Diocese of Newfoundland, December 11, 1929. John Francis BENOIT, age 27, bachelor and fisherman of St. Paul's, son of John Henry BENOIT, fisherman and May Goilie PAYNE, age 19, spinster of Cow Head, daughter of Albert PAYNE, fisherman. Married in the School Chapel according to the Rites and Ceremonies of the Church of England, by me James A. REES (Priest). This marriage was solemnized between us: his mark of X John Francis BENOIT & May Golie PAYNE. In the presence of us: his mark of X Charles E. BENOIT, Edna E. JOYCE.
